Here you can select the file and quality settings from the preset list, including "DVD NTSC", "DVD PAL", "VCD NTSC", "VCD PAL", "High quality", "Standard play", etc.
Click "Advanced>>" button, hit "Aspect correction", and select aspect from "4:3" or "16:9", and crop scale if necessary.
When all the parameters are set and the preparations are made you can click the "Convert Now!" button to start the conversion process. If the file size is too big the following window will pop up suggesting that you choose additional conversion and burning parameters. Select "Standard DVD disc" if you do not have a double-layer disc or your DVD drive does not support such discs. You can either use two single layer discs or shrink the video to fit one disc.
If you have a possibility to record a dual-layer disc it is recommended to use "Double-layer DVD disc" option. After that you can click "OK" to start conversion. 4. Burning DVD
